一、引言
随着移动互联网的飞速发展,购物小程序已成为电商领域的重要一环。它不仅为用户提供了便捷、快速的购物体验,还为商家带来了更多的流量和销售机会。本文将详细介绍如何开发制作一个功能完善的购物小程序,帮助您从零到一打造属于自己的电商平台。
二、需求分析
在开发购物小程序之前,首先需要进行需求分析。这包括明确目标用户群体、了解用户需求、确定小程序的核心功能等。例如,您可能需要考虑用户是否希望在小程序中查看商品详情、下单购买、支付结算、查看订单状态等功能。通过需求分析,您可以为小程序的开发提供明确的方向和目标。
三、技术选型
技术选型是开发购物小程序的关键步骤之一。您需要选择合适的前端框架、后端技术栈、数据库等。例如,前端可以选择微信小程序原生框架或Uni-app等跨平台框架;后端可以选择Node.js、Java、PHP等技术栈;数据库可以选择MySQL、MongoDB等。在选择技术时,需要考虑技术的成熟度、稳定性、可扩展性以及团队的技术储备等因素。
四、UI设计
UI设计是购物小程序开发的重要环节。一个好的UI设计可以提升用户体验,增加用户粘性。在UI设计时,需要考虑小程序的整体风格、色彩搭配、页面布局、图标设计等因素。同时,还需要确保小程序在不同设备、不同屏幕尺寸下的适配性和一致性。
五、功能实现
在功能实现阶段,您需要按照需求分析的结果,逐步实现小程序的核心功能。这包括商品展示、购物车管理、订单管理、支付结算等功能。在实现功能时,需要注意代码的可读性、可维护性以及性能优化等方面。同时,还需要确保小程序的安全性,防止数据泄露、恶意攻击等问题。
六、支付接口集成
支付接口是购物小程序不可或缺的一部分。您需要选择合适的支付平台(如微信支付、支付宝等),并按照其提供的API文档进行集成。在集成支付接口时,需要注意支付流程的设计、支付安全性的保障以及异常处理等方面。
七、用户体验优化
用户体验是购物小程序成功的关键。您需要从用户的角度出发,不断优化小程序的使用体验。这包括提高页面加载速度、优化操作流程、增加用户反馈机制等方面。同时,还需要关注用户的反馈和需求,及时调整和优化小程序的功能和设计。
八、测试上线
在测试阶段,您需要对小程序进行全面的测试,包括功能测试、性能测试、兼容性测试等方面。通过测试,可以发现并修复潜在的问题,确保小程序的质量和稳定性。在测试通过后,您可以将小程序提交至相关平台进行审核和上线。在上线后,还需要持续监控小程序的运行状态,及时处理用户反馈和问题。
九、运营推广
购物小程序的运营推广是获取用户和流量的重要手段。您可以通过社交媒体、广告投放、线下活动等方式进行推广。同时,还需要关注小程序的SEO优化、用户留存率等指标,不断优化运营策略和提高用户粘性。
十、总结与展望
本文详细介绍了如何开发制作一个功能完善的购物小程序。通过需求分析、技术选型、UI设计、功能实现、支付接口集成、用户体验优化、测试上线以及运营推广等步骤,您可以打造一个属于自己的电商平台。未来,随着技术的不断进步和用户需求的变化,购物小程序也将不断发展和完善。我们期待更多的开发者加入到这个领域中来,共同推动购物小程序的发展和创新。